Why These Are the Top Bathroom Remodeling Contractors in Bristow

** The bathroom remodeling market for Bristow, NE, is characterized by its reliance on regional contractors from larger nearby towns like O'Neill, Spencer, and Norfolk. Due to the rural nature of the area, there are no large, specialized bathroom remodeling chains. The market consists primarily of established, local general contractors who offer bathroom remodeling as a core part of their service portfolio. Competition is moderate among these regional players, who build their reputation on word-of-mouth and long-term community presence. Quality is generally high, as these contractors rely on their local reputation. Typical pricing for a full bathroom remodel in this region can range from $10,000 for a basic update with standard materials to $25,000+ for a high-end renovation with custom tile work, accessibility features, and premium fixtures. Homeowners should expect to factor in potential travel fees for contractors based outside of Bristow. It is highly recommended to obtain multiple detailed quotes and check references before proceeding with a project.

1What is the typical cost range for a full bathroom remodel in Bristow, Nebraska?

For a full remodel in Bristow, costs typically range from $10,000 to $25,000, depending on the size of the bathroom, material selections, and the extent of plumbing/electrical work. Regional factors like the cost of transporting materials to our rural area and the availability of local subcontractors can influence the final price. It's wise to budget an additional 10-15% for unexpected issues common in older homes in the region.

2How does Nebraska's climate and Bristow's rural location affect my remodeling timeline and material choices?

Nebraska's significant temperature swings and dry winters mean we prioritize materials resistant to expansion/contraction and recommend proper ventilation to manage humidity. Being rural, specialized material deliveries to Bristow can add time, so planning and ordering well in advance is crucial. We often suggest scheduling major demolition and construction during milder seasons to avoid extreme weather delays.

3Are there specific local permits or regulations in Bristow, NE, I need to know about for a bathroom remodel?

Yes, while Bristow itself is a village, you must comply with Antelope County building codes. This typically requires permits for any structural, electrical, or plumbing changes. A reputable local contractor will handle this process, ensuring work meets state and local standards for safety, which is especially important for proper septic system tie-ins common in our area.

4What should I look for when choosing a bathroom remodeling contractor in the Bristow area?

Look for a contractor with verifiable local references and physical presence in Antelope or nearby counties, as they understand the logistics of working here. Ensure they are licensed, insured, and familiar with working with well water systems and septic tanks, which are prevalent.
